2.                                       Shelf Registrations.

(a)                                  Shelf Registration.  The Company agrees to use commercially reasonable efforts to file with the Commission a registration statement under the Securities Act for the offering on a continuous or delayed basis in the future covering resales of the Registrable Securities (the “Shelf Registration Statement”), such filing to be made (subject to Section 3) on or prior to the date which is fourteen (14) days after the later of (i) the date on which the Series A Units may be exchanged for Common Shares pursuant to the provisions of the Contribution Agreement or (ii) such other date as may be required by the Commission pursuant to its interpretation of applicable federal securities laws and the rules and regulations promulgated thereunder.  The Company shall use commercially reasonable efforts to cause such Shelf Registration Statement to be declared effective by the Commission as soon as practicable thereafter.  The Shelf Registration Statement shall be on an appropriate form and the registration statement and any form of prospectus included therein (or prospectus supplement relating thereto) shall reflect the plan of distribution or method of sale as the Holders may from time to time notify the Company.

(b)                                 Effectiveness.  The Company shall use commercially reasonable efforts to keep the Shelf Registration Statement continuously effective for the period beginning on the date on which the Shelf Registration Statement is declared effective and ending on the date that all of the Registrable Securities registered under the Shelf Registration Statement cease to be Registrable Securities.  During the period that the Shelf Registration Statement is effective, the Company shall supplement or make amendments to the Shelf Registration Statement, if required by the Securities Act or if reasonably requested by the Holders (whether or not required by the form on which the securities are being registered), including to reflect any specific plan of distribution or method of sale, and shall use commercially reasonable efforts to have such supplements and amendments declared effective, if required, as soon as practicable after filing.

3.                                       Black-Out Periods.

Notwithstanding anything herein to the contrary, the Company shall have the right, exercisable from time to time by delivery of a notice authorized by the Board, on not more than two (2) occasions in any 12-month period, to require the Holders not to sell pursuant to a registration statement or similar document under the Securities Act filed pursuant to Section 2 or to suspend the effectiveness thereof if at the time of the delivery of such notice, the Board has considered a plan to engage no later than sixty (60) days following the date of such notice in a firm commitment underwritten public offering or if the Board has reasonably and in good faith determined that such registration and offering, continued effectiveness or sale would materially interfere with any material transaction involving the Company; provided, however, that in no event shall the black-out period extend for more than sixty (60) days on any such occasion.  The Company, as soon as practicable, shall (i) give the Holders prompt written notice in the event that the Company has suspended sales of Registrable Securities pursuant to this Section 3, (ii) give the Holders prompt written notice of the completion of such offering or material transaction and (iii) promptly file any amendment necessary for any registration statement or prospectus of the Holders in connection with the completion of such event.




Each Holder agrees by acquisition of the Registrable Securities that upon receipt of any notice from the Company of the happening of any event of the kind described in this Section 3, such Holder will forthwith discontinue its disposition of Registrable Securities pursuant to the registration statement relating to such Registrable Securities until such Holder’s receipt of the notice of completion of such event.

5.                                       Indemnification.

(a)                                  Indemnification by the Company.  The Company agrees to indemnify and hold harmless each Holder, its partners, officers, directors, trustees, stockholders, employees, agents and investment advisers, and each Person, if any, who controls such Holder within the meaning of the Securities Act or the Exchange Act, together with the partners, officers, directors, trustees, stockholders, employees, agents and investment advisers of such controlling person, against any losses, claims, damages, and expenses (including, without limitation, reasonable attorneys’ fees), joint or several, to which the Holders or any such indemnitees may become subject under the Securities Act or otherwise, insofar as such losses, claims, damages, liabilities and expenses (or actions or proceedings, whether commenced or threatened, in respect thereof) arise out of or are based upon any untrue statement or alleged untrue statement of any material fact contained in the registration statement under which such Registrable Securities were registered and sold under the Securities Act, including any periodic or current reports or other filings incorporated by reference




into such registration statement, any preliminary prospectus, final prospectus or summary prospectus contained therein, or any amendment or supplement thereto, or arising out of or based upon any omission or alleged omission to state therein a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ein, in light of the circumstances under which they were made, not misleading or any violation of the Securities Act or state securities laws or rules thereunder by the Company relating to any action or inaction by the Company in connection with such registration and the Company will reimburse each Holder for any reasonable legal or any other expenses reasonably incurred by it in connection with investigating or defending any such loss, claim, liability, action or proceedings; provided, however, that the Company shall not be liable in any such case to the extent that any such loss, claim, damage, liability (or action or proceeding in respect thereof) or expense arises out of or is based upon an untrue statement or alleged statement or omission or alleged omission made in such registration statement, any such preliminary prospectus, final prospectus, summary prospectus, amendment or supplement in reliance upon and in conformity with written information furnished to the Company by any Holder specifically stating that it is for use in the preparation thereof; and provided, further, that the Company shall not be liable to the Holders or any other Person who controls such Holder within the meaning of the Securities Act or the Exchange Act in any such case to the extent that any such loss, claim, damage, liability (or action or proceeding in respect thereof) or expense arises out of such Person’s failure to send or give a copy of the final prospectus or supplement to the Persons asserting an untrue statement or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ission at or prior to the written confirmation of the sale of Registrable Securities to such Person if such statement or omission was corrected in such final prospectus or supplement the filing date of which was prior to the date of the sale of the Registrable Securities giving rise to the Company’s indemnification obligation.  Such indemnity shall remain in full force and effect regardless of any investigation made by or on behalf of the Holders or any such controlling Person and shall survive the transfer of such securities by the Holders.

(b)                                 Indemnification by the Holders.  Each Holder agrees to indemnify and hold harmless (in the same manner and to the same extent as set forth in Section 5(a)) the Company, each member of the Board, each officer, employee, agent and investment adviser of the Company and each other Person, if any, who controls any of the foregoing within the meaning of the Securities Act or the Exchange Act, with respect to any untrue statement or alleged untrue statement of a material fact in or omission or alleged omission to state a material fact from such registration statement, any preliminary prospectus, final prospectus or summary prospectus contained therein, or any amendment or supplement thereto, if such untrue statement or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ission was made in reliance upon and in conformity with written information furnished to the Company by such Holder regarding such Holder giving such indemnification specifically stating that it is for use in the preparation of such registration statement, preliminary prospectus, final prospectus, summary prospectus, amendment or supplement, provided, however, that the Holder shall not be liable to the Company or any other Person if such statement or omission was corrected in such final prospectus or supplement the filing date of which was prior to the date of the sale of the Registrable Securities giving rise to the Holder’s indemnification obligation.  Such indemnity shall remain in full force and effect regardless of any investigation made by or on behalf of the Company or any such Board member, officer, employee, agent, investment adviser or controlling Person and shall survive the transfer of such securities by any Holder.  The obligation of a Holder to indemnify will be several and not joint among the Holders of Registrable Securities and the liability of each such Holder of Registrable Securities will be in proportion to and limited in all events to the net amount received by such Holder from the sale of Registrable Securities pursuant to such registration statement.




(c)                                  Notices of Claims, etc.  Promptly after receipt by an indemnified party of notice of the commencement of any action or proceeding involving a claim referred to in the preceding paragraphs of this Section 5, such indemnified party will, if a claim in respect thereof is to be made against an indemnifying party, give written notice to the latter of the commencement of such action; provided, however, that the failure of any indemnified party to give notice as provided herein shall not relieve the indemnifying party of its obligations under the preceding paragraphs of this Section 5, except to the extent that the indemnifying party is actually prejudiced by such failure to give notice.  In case any such action is brought against an indemnified party, unless in such indemnified party’s reasonable judgment a conflict of interest between such indemnified and indemnifying parties may exist in respect of such claim, the indemnifying party shall be entitled to assume the defense thereof, for itself, if applicable, together with any other indemnified party similarly notified, and after notice from the indemnifying party to such indemnified party of its election so to assume the defense thereof, the indemnifying party shall not be liable to the indemnified party for any legal or other expenses subsequently incurred by the latter in connection with the defense thereof.

(d)                                 Indemnification Payments.  To the extent that the indemnifying party does not assume the defense of an action brought against the indemnified party as provided in Section 5(c), the indemnified party (or parties if there is more than one) shall be entitled to the reasonable legal expenses of common counsel for the indemnified party (or parties).  In such event, however, the indemnifying party will not be liable for any settlement effected without the written consent of such indemnifying party,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ld.  The indemnification required by this Section 5 shall be made by periodic payments of the amount thereof during the course of an investigation or defense, as and when bills are received or expense, loss, damage or liability is incurred.  The indemnifying party shall not settle any claim without the consent of the indemnified party,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ld, unless such settlement involves a complete release of such indemnified party without any admission of liability by the indemnified party.

(e)                                  Contribution.  If, for any reason, the foregoing indemnity is unavailable, or is insufficient to hold harmless an indemnified party, then the indemnifying party shall contribute to the amount paid or payable by the indemnified party as a result of the expense, loss, damage or liability, (i) in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ect the relative fault of the indemnifying party on the one hand and the indemnified party on the other (determined by reference to, among other things, whether the unt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act or omission relates to information supplied by the indemnifying party or the indemnified party and the parties’ relative intent, knowledge, access to information and opportunity to correct or prevent such untrue statement or omission) or (ii) if the allocation provided by subclause (i) above is not permitted by applicable law or provides a lesser sum to the indemnified party than the amount hereinafter calculated, in the proportion as is appropriate to reflect not only the relative fault of the indemnifying party and the indemnified party, but also the relative benefits received by the indemnifying party on the one hand and the indemnified party on the other, as well as any other relevant equitable considerations.  No indemnified party guilty of fraudulent misrepresentation (within the meaning of Section 11(f) of the Securities Act) shall be entitled to contribution from any indemnifying party who was not guilty of such fraudulent misrepresentation, and the liability for contribution of each Holder of Registrable Securities will be in proportion to and limited in all events to the net amount received by such Holder from the sale of Registrable Securities pursuant to such registration statement.

6.                                       Market Stand-Off Agreement.  Each Holder hereby agrees that it shall not, to the extent requested by the Company or an underwriter of securities of the Company, directly or indirectly sell, offer




to sell (including without limitation any short sale), grant any option or otherwise transfer or dispose of any Registrable Securities (other than to donees or partners of the Holder who agree to be similarly bound) within seven days prior to and for up to 90 days following the effective date of a registration statement of the Company filed under the Securities Act or the date of an underwriting agreement with respect to an underwritten public offering of the Company’s securities (the “Stand-Off Period”); provided, however, that:

(a)                                  with respect to the Stand-Off Period, such agreement shall not be applicable to the Registrable Securities to be sold on the Holder’s behalf to the public in an underwritten offering pursuant to such registration statement;

(b)                                 all executive officers and directors of the Company then holding Common Stock of the Company shall enter into similar agreements;

(c)                                  the Company shall use commercially reasonable efforts to obtain similar agreements from each 5% or greater shareholder of the Company; and

(d)                                 the Holders shall be allowed any concession or proportionate release allowed to any (i) officer, (ii) director or (iii) other 5% or greater shareholder of the Company that entered into similar agreements.

In order to enforce the foregoing covenant, the Company shall have the right to place restrictive legends on the certificates representing the Registrable Securities subject to this Section 6 and to impose stop transfer instructions with respect to the Registrable Securities and such other Common Shares of each Holder (and the Common Shares or securities of every other Person subject to the foregoing restriction) until the end of such period.

7.                                       Covenants Relating To Rule 144.  At such times as the Company becomes obligated to file reports in compliance with either Section 13 or 15(d) of the Exchange Act, the Company covenants that it will file any reports required to be filed by it under the Securities Act and the Exchange Act and that it will take such further action as any Holder may reasonably request, all to the extent required from time to time to enable Holders to sell Registrable Securities without registration under the Securities Act within the limitation of the exemptions provided by (a) Rule 144 under the Securities Act, as such rule may be amended from time to time or (b) any similar rule or regulation hereafter adopted by the Commission.
